1. MPOWERD: Inflatable Solar Camping Light Pioneer
Core Highlights: MPOWERD’s Luci series is a pioneer in inflatable solar camping lights, and our 2-week hands-on testing confirmed its reliability in real outdoor scenarios. The inflatable, collapsible design (weighs only 5.5-6.0 oz) makes it incredibly easy to pack—you can even stuff it into a small pocket of your backpack without adding extra bulk. It delivers a maximum runtime of 50 hours on a single charge, which is 2-3 times longer than many compact solar camping lights on the market. Its 10 cool white LEDs produce 150 lumens of soft light, which is bright enough for reading in a tent or illuminating a small campsite without dazzling your eyes. There are 4 light modes (low/medium/high/SOS) to adapt to different scenarios: low mode is perfect for overnight use in a tent, while SOS mode is critical for emergency situations. The 2000mAh built-in lithium-ion battery charges fully in 14 hours of direct sunlight (we tested this on a sunny day in California, and it reached 100% charge in 13.5 hours) or 2-3 hours via USB. Most impressively, it’s fully waterproof (IP67 rating), surviving submersion in 1m of water for 30 minutes—we accidentally dropped it in a lake during testing, and it continued working perfectly after being retrieved.

2. XTAUTO: Best-Selling Foldable Solar Camping Light on Amazon
Core Highlights: XTAUTO is a hidden champion in the outdoor lighting market, and its foldable solar camping light has seen a 154% sales growth rate on Amazon US in 2025—our testing explains why. It boasts an 18% solar conversion efficiency (10W photovoltaic panel), which is 3% higher than the category average (15%). This means it charges faster than most competitors: we tested it on a partly cloudy day, and it reached 80% charge in 6 hours, while a similar foldable light from another brand only reached 65% in the same time.
The light expands to 20cm for 360° illumination, which is great for illuminating a small family campsite, and folds down to 10cm×5cm (palm-sized) when not in use, weighing only 200g. The 2000mAh battery offers 40-hour runtime in low mode (perfect for overnight use) or 8-hour runtime in high mode (300 lumens), which is bright enough to light up a 10-square-meter tent. It also has a USB-C port that can charge phones (5V/2A)—we tested this by charging an iPhone 15, and it added 30% battery life in 30 minutes. With an IPX6 waterproof rating, it resists heavy rain—we left it outside during a thunderstorm for 2 hours, and it continued working without any issues.

7. LETRY: Motion-Sensor Solar Camping Light for Energy Saving
Core Highlights: LETRY’s solar camping light stands out with its built-in PIR motion sensor (detection range: 3-5 meters, 120° angle), which automatically turns on when human movement is detected and turns off after 30 seconds of inactivity—great for energy saving. It delivers 250 lumens with 3 light modes (sensor/low/high) and has a 1800mAh battery that supports 48-hour runtime in sensor mode. Solar charging takes 6-7 hours, and USB charging takes 1.5 hours, with IPX5 waterproof rating.
Target Audience & Scenarios: Perfect for budget-conscious campers, RV travelers, and cross-border sellers focusing on cost-performance products. Ideal for RV awnings, tent entrances, and outdoor corridors—avoids wasting power on continuous illumination. Popular in Southeast Asian and South American markets due to its affordable price.
Notes: Motion sensor sensitivity may decrease in low temperatures. With a minimum order quantity of only 100 units, it’s an excellent choice for small cross-border sellers testing new emerging markets.

9. uuffoo: Detachable Solar Panel Camping Light for Flexible Use
Core Highlights: uuffoo’s unique selling point is its detachable solar panel—you can place the panel in direct sunlight while using the light in a shaded area (e.g., inside a tent). The light itself weighs only 220g, with 300 lumens and 4 light modes. The 2000mAh battery supports 40-hour runtime in low mode, and USB-C fast charging allows full charge in 1.5 hours. The detachable panel also supports charging other small devices, with IPX6 waterproof rating for both light and panel.
Target Audience & Scenarios: Ideal for backpackers who need flexible charging solutions, tent campers, and cross-border sellers focusing on innovative functional products. Suitable for scenarios where the light source and charging area are separated, such as forest camping or cave exploration. Popular among tech-savvy outdoor enthusiasts in the US and Canada.
Notes: The detachable cable is relatively thin; avoid pulling it hard. It complies with FCC and CE certifications, and supports custom packaging and logo printing, helping cross-border sellers enhance brand differentiation.
